Suresh Kumar Gawre is a researcher whose work lies at the intersection of robotics, autonomous navigation, and the Internet of Things (IoT). His primary research areas include mobile robot path planning, humanoid robotics, and the application of IoT in agricultural automation. Gawre’s most significant contribution is his highly cited 2017 survey on autonomous mobile robot path planning approaches, which has garnered 53 citations and serves as a foundational reference for researchers tackling the core challenges of perception, localization, cognition, and path planning in robotics. He has also explored practical, interdisciplinary applications, such as developing an IoT-based smart tea leaves plucker using a two-revolute planar manipulator—a project that demonstrates his commitment to merging automation with real-world agricultural needs. More recently, Gawre has contributed to the field of humanoid robotics, examining the latest advancements toward creating truly human-like artificial agents. His work reflects a broad technical range, from theoretical frameworks in navigation to applied robotics in agriculture, making him a versatile contributor to the robotics and automation community.
